What is a Mini Yorkshire Terrier?
The Mini Yorkshire Terrier is a smaller sized version of the conventional Yorkshire Terrier, which typically weighs 4 to 7 pounds. These small dogs generally weigh between 2 to 4 pounds and stand about 6 to 7 inches high. This diminutive size makes them an excellent option for apartment occupants and those with limited area. Regardless of their little stature, Mini Yorkies Kaufen have big personalities and are frequently characterized as spirited, caring, and spirited.

Health Considerations
While Mini Yorkshire Terriers are usually healthy, they can be vulnerable to particular health issues. Awareness and preventive care can reduce numerous of these risks.
Health IssueDescriptionDental ProblemsLittle mouths can cause overcrowded teeth; regular dental care is essential.Patellar LuxationA typical issue in small breeds where the kneecap dislocates. Routine veterinarian check-ups can help catch this early.HypoglycemiaLow blood sugar level is particularly important in little breeds; preserving a regular feeding schedule is essential.Collapsing TracheaA condition frequently seen in little breeds, leading to coughing and breathing difficulties.
